Jakarta as the center of the economy and central of government has a double burden which causes its performance as a capital city to not run optimally. Moving the country's capital from Jakarta to East Kalimantan will have impacts for changing the government administration structure in the new capital city. Apart from that, it is hoped that moving the nation's capital will create equality in various fields of justice. Indonesia is a very large country with a population of approximately 280 million people, it is impossible for economic and business development to only be centered on the Java’s island, so that it will create an imbalance in economic growth between Java and outside Java. This research aims to examine and analyze state legal politics regarding the deliver the capital city as regulated in the national capital city (IKN) Law. The research method used a normative research , namely a research method that focuses research on the study of legal norms related to the birth of Law no. 3 of 2002 concerning IKN. With various views, both agreeing and disagreeing, the government has begun implementing the development of the state capital in East Kalimantan with the mission of creating fair equality. With the construction of the Archipelago Capital, it is hoped that visionary governance can be formed and bring a fast change to the new Capital City and it is hoped that it can impact economic growth in the surrounding area
